http://issues.apache.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=29453 Multiple Cell's of different heights in table vertical-align="top", is not working Summary: Multiple Cell's of different heights in table vertical- align="top", is not working Product: Fop Version: 0.20.5 Platform: Sun OS/Version: Solaris Status: NEW Severity: Normal Priority: Other Component: general AssignedTo: [EMAIL PROTECTED] ReportedBy: [EMAIL PROTECTED] Hi, I am looping through a list creating one "<fo:table-row vertical-align="top">" per loop, there is multiple " <fo:table-cell padding-start="3pt" padding- end="3pt" padding-before="3pt" padding-after="3pt" display-align="center" text- align="start" border-style="solid" border-width="1pt" border-color="white">" in the loop of different heights. In the produced PDF, the output seems to be exhibiting "vertical- align="center">" for the cells. i.e. the data is placed center of the cell, opposed to the center by definition. As a precaution I also defined "<fo:table-body vertical-align="top">" at table level, but it seems to not make a difference. Is this a bug in FO ? kind regards. .kenny
